In the word atypical, the prefix a means not; atypical means not typical.

Is the prefix UN Greek or Latin.?

If you mean the prefix "uni-" (unicellular, etc.), then it comes from the Latin word unus, meaning "one". (The nearly-equivalent prefix "mono-", however, comes from Greek.)
